Pedro Roquet has a well-equipped materials laboratory which is responsible for material supplier approval, approval of manufacturing processes such as casting, welding, plating and heat-treatment . The deoartment is also responsible for quality control of incoming materials.

These are some of the main test and inspection and facilities available in the laboratory:
Tensile test machine to test material samples
Salt-mist corrosion test chamber for testing corrosion resistance of plated valves, chromed rods of cylinders etc.
Particle counter
Device to measure water content of hydraulic fluids
Digital microscope
